Description: Jurassic Park Builder is a mobile game where players can build their own Jurassic Park by collecting dinosaurs and designing enclosures and attractions. The goal is to attract visitors to earn resources for expansion.

Jurassic Park Builder
Jurassic Park Builder Features
  • - Build and customize your own Jurassic Park island
  • - Collect over 100 different dinosaurs and prehistoric creatures
  • - Design enclosures, restaurants, gardens and more
  • - Interact with dinosaurs through mini games and tasks
  • - Level up and evolve dinosaurs to new hybrid species
  • - Complete missions and challenges
  • - Battle other players in the Battle Arena
  • - VIP membership unlocks special perks and bonuses

Jurassic Park Builder
Jurassic Park Builder
Pros
  • - High quality 3D graphics and animations
  • - Lots of dinosaurs and creatures to collect
  • - Fun and addictive gameplay loop
  • - Good progression system with leveling and evolving
  • - Social features allow interacting with others
Cons
  • - Can feel repetitive after a while
  • - Wait times to complete builds can be frustrating
  • - Aggressive monetization and push for in-app purchases
